You’ve seen the commercials for Stella Artois. A bartender pours a perfect glass of beer, measures the head, then takes a knife and slices away the excess foam to create an object of beauty. This is beer porn at its finest.

Turns out, pouring the perfect pint is both art form and competition. On October 7, finalists from around the country will converge on Washington D.C. for the 2011 World Draught Masters Competition.

It is there, that seven regional winners will compete in the nine-step process that results in a picture perfect pour.

Miami has been chosen as one of the cities to hold a regional contest.

This Friday at Brickell Irish Pub from 8 p.m. to midnight,

bartenders from around south Florida will compete to see who has what

it takes to move on to the finals.
